Bioactivity Lacripep is a synthetic tear protein. Lacripep binds to and activates syndecan-1 (SDC1). Lacripep restores progenitor cell identity and epithelial barrier function. Lacripep resolves dry eye[1].
CAS 2243095-21-6
Sequence Ac-Lys-Gln-Phe-Ile-Glu-Asn-Gly-Ser-Glu-Phe-Ala-Gln-Lys-Leu-Leu-Lys-Lys-Phe-Ser-NH2
Shortening Ac-KQFIENGSEFAQKLLKKFS-NH2
Formula C106H167N27O29
Molar Mass 2283.62
